    Has anyone here ever done or know of a place where I could do a motorbike maintenance course??

    Based in Dublin, working in the city,


Comments

  • Closed Accounts Posts: 1,268 ✭✭✭Tomohawk


    Ring Dit Bolton Street, course starts in late september each year, dept. of mechanical engineering. Its a 3 year course about 900 euro a year. First year covers the basics, class is split 50/50 on theory and practical workshop experience. its good craic too...
